How much do process safety eng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for process safety engineer in Baton Rouge, LA is $99,020.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$86,600.00 and $112,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does a Process Safety Engineer Do?

Process safety engineers work to decrease risk and ensure safety in construction and manufacturing companies. They assess the work conditions and identify potential risks and offers cost-effective solutions to diminish or remove those hazards. You find process safety engineers in many industries, including construction, manufacturing, and aerospace. To become a process safety engineer, you must have a b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ering, chemical engineering, or a related field. Additional qualifications include strong technical and mechanical skills and experience in a manufacturing environ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Process Safety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Process Safety Engineer, you need a solid background in chemical or mechanical engineering, risk assessment, and regulatory compliance, usually supported by a relevant engineering degree. Familiarity with process simulation software, hazard analysis tools (such as HAZOP or LOPA), and certifications like CSP or CCPSC are commonly required. Attention to detail, strong analytical thinking, and effective communication help professionals excel in identifying and mitigating risks. These skills and qualifications are crucial to ensuring operational safety, regulatory adherence, and the prevention of industrial accidents.

What are Process Safety Engineers?

Process Safety Engineers are professionals who focus on identifying, evaluating, and mitigating risks associated with industrial processes, particularly those involving hazardous materials or conditions. Their primary goal is to prevent accidents, fires, explosions, and environmental releases by designing and implementing safety protocols and systems. They work closely with engineering teams, management, and regulatory agencies to ensure compliance with safety standards and promote a culture of safety within organizations. Process Safety Engineers also investigate incidents, conduct hazard analyses, and develop emergency response plans.

What is the difference between Process Safety Engineer vs Process Engineer?

AspectProcess Safety EngineerProcess Engineer
CredentialsTypically requires a degree in chemical, mechanical, or safety engineering; certifications like ASP or CSP are commonRequires a degree in chemical, mechanical, or industrial engineering; certifications are less common
Work EnvironmentFocuses on safety protocols, hazard analysis, and risk management in industrial plantsDesigns, optimizes, and oversees manufacturing processes in similar settings
Industry UsageUsed in industries with high safety risks like oil & gas, chemicals, and refiningUsed across manufacturing, chemical, and process industries for process development

The Process Safety Engineer primarily concentrates on hazard prevention, safety protocols, and risk mitigation to ensure safe operations. In contrast, the Process Engineer focuses on designing and improving manufacturing processes. Both roles require engineering backgrounds but differ in their core responsibilities and safety emphasis.

The Position:
We are looking for an entry level Chemical Process Engineer with a wide variety of abilities that complements ISC's culture of integrity. The Chemical Process Engineer will provide technical support on process engineering and process safety endeavors and have the ability to lead such endeavors.
Applicants should have the ability to:
  • Model unit operations in simulation software
  • Perform hydraulic calculations
  • Perform Material & Energy Balance calculations
  • Develop Process Flow Diagrams
  • Develop Piping & Instrumentation Diagrams
  • Support the preparation of Equipment and Instrumentation Specifications
  • Perform Relief Device Sizing calculations.
  • Model release events in dispersion modeling software
  • Support and facilitate Process Hazard Analysis meetings
  • Lead process engineering activities within multi-discipline engineering projects
  • Support all engineering phases from concept to construction for new and expansion projects
  • Support capital cost estimates for projects
  • Communicate effectively with ISC team members as well as client representatives
